Google は、黒人コミュニティのための人種的公平の促進に取り組んでいます。詳細をご覧ください。

nl ::織り::プロファイル:: DataManagement_Current :: LogBDXUpload

概要

コンストラクタとデストラクタ

LogBDXUpload (void)

パブリックタイプ

UploaderState列挙型

パブリック属性

mState
UploaderState

公の行事

Abort (void)
void
BlockHandler (nl::Weave::Profiles::BulkDataTransfer::BDXTransfer *aXfer, uint64_t *aLength, uint8_t **aDataBlock, bool *aIsLastBlock)
void
Done (void)
void
GetUploadPosition (void)
uint32_t
Init ( LoggingManagement *inLogger)
Shutdown (void)
void
StartUpload ( nl::Weave::Binding *aBinding)

パブリックタイプ

UploaderState

 UploaderState

パブリック属性

mState

UploaderState mState

公の行事

アボート

void Abort(
  void
)

ブロックハンドラー

void BlockHandler(
  nl::Weave::Profiles::BulkDataTransfer::BDXTransfer *aXfer,
  uint64_t *aLength,
  uint8_t **aDataBlock,
  bool *aIsLastBlock
)

完了

void Done(
  void
)

GetUploadPosition

uint32_t GetUploadPosition(
  void
)

初期化

WEAVE_ERROR Init(
  LoggingManagement *inLogger
)

LogBDXUpload

 LogBDXUpload(
  void
)

シャットダウン

void Shutdown(
  void
)

StartUpload

WEAVE_ERROR StartUpload(
  nl::Weave::Binding *aBinding
)